**Leadership Review: Brightline Kettleware Pricing**

Quick heads-up before Thursday's session: the Brightline line is underpriced versus the mid-tier market, and margins slipped again last quarter. Marla's team suggests a 6% uplift on the Copperidge models and holding the entry range flat. We'll walk through the numbers together, but the direction below should stay in this room.

internal memo for hafog-hadug: The pricing group signed off on a budget of $16.1 million for Project Gorir. The renewal with Oliionax Systems closes at $14.1 million a year, 46 percent above the last contract.

## Approvals — Password Reset Revamp

Quick heads-up: the Lanternbrook reset flow revamp (magic-link plus step-up verification) is code-complete and sitting in staging. Before it ships, we need three boxes ticked: security review, copy review for the new emails, and a rollback plan filed. Security and copy are done; rollback doc landed yesterday. That leaves the final release approval, which can't come from the implementing team. The approver on record for this release is below.

approver of yawig-yajef = Briius Jorix

Escalation: Encoding Detection Failures

When Textwell's upload pipeline flags more than five encoding-detection mismatches per hour, first confirm the charset sniffer service is running and check the sampler logs for truncated byte sequences. If files from a single tenant are affected, capture two sample uploads before escalating. Do not attempt manual re-encoding yourself, as this can corrupt the originals. For all unresolved cases, escalate to the Parsing Platform team directly.

escalation mailbox, hadug-bajog: sormir@norvalabs.internal

Subject: Welcome to the Quillpress on-call rotation

Hi, and welcome aboard. You're now in the rotation for Quillpress, our markdown rendering pipeline. Most pages render in under 50 ms; when they don't, the usual culprits are the sanitizer stage or a stuck embed-resolver worker. Please never restart the renderer fleet without first draining the cache warmers, as future maintainers have learned this the hard way. The runbook covers escalation order, safe restart steps, and known flaky fixtures, and lives at the internal page noted below.

operations page: https://jenkins.zemvarcloud.local/job/merge_requests/repo/build/73930b4b30f0a8ed